Disappointed. Went to this restaurant during a trip to Phoenix based on reviews on this website. We were a group of 11 and went specifically for happy hour. Arrived just before 5:30 and ordered drinks, waiter was a little preoccupied and didn’t return for a bit, when he did he explained the menu and offered his recommendations. He left and didn’t return until 6 when happy hour ended. He told us then he couldn’t put any happy hour choices through as it was past 6. He should have told us this when we entered and he knew we were there for the happy hour as we told him. Then had to order off of regular menu and ordered what he suggested. Bone marrow was just ok and not a meal at all and also ordered the plate with pickled options and salami’s which was disappointing, the items with mostly pickled and the salami’s were basically a plate of kolbassa. Unfortunately for us, this restaurant did not hit the mark. Waiter should have told us orders for happy hour needed to be placed before 6 which he didn’t. We felt like the emphasis was to order at regular prices. The waiter did not apologize and instead said we took too long to decide when it was he who took too long to take our order or tell us we must place our order for happy hour before 6. Cannot recommend this restaurant.
